| | 5-Amino-1-methylpyrazole-4-carboxamide Usage And Synthesis |
| Synthesis | The general procedure for the synthesis of 5-amino-1-methyl-1H-pyrazole-4-carboxamide from 1-methyl-4-cyano-5-amino-1,2-pyrazole was carried out as follows: a mixture of 1-methyl-4-cyano-5-amino-1,2-pyrazole (0.11 mol) and concentrated sulfuric acid (30 mL, 0.6 mol) was stirred for 1 h at room temperature. Upon completion of the reaction, the mixture was slowly poured into ice water and the pH was adjusted to 8 with 50% aqueous ammonium hydroxide under ice bath conditions.Subsequently, the precipitated solid product was filtered and washed with cold water to give the final 5-amino-1-methyl-1H-pyrazole-4-carboxamide (13.5 g, 91% yield). | | References | [1] Patent: WO2009/97446, 2009, A1.
